> +static inline void h_aie_lock(CPUArchState *env, hwaddr paddr)
> +{
> +    AIEEntry *entry = aie_entry_get_lock(paddr);
> +
> +    env->aie_entry = entry;
> +    env->aie_locked = true;
> +}
> +
> +static inline void h_aie_unlock(CPUArchState *env)
> +{
> +    assert(env->aie_entry && env->aie_locked);
> +    qemu_spin_unlock(&env->aie_entry->lock);
> +    env->aie_locked = false;
> +}

This is a little unbalanced as aie_entry_get_lock() returns the entry
with the lock grabbed but we free it in h_aie_unlock. Should we either
grab the lock in the helper or have a helper to free the lock that can
be kept in the aie utils?
